					<description><![CDATA[<p>The Nigerian Senate has begun moves to introduce a comprehensive framework for regulating, coordinating and monitoring foreign aid, grants and donations received in the country. The proposed legislation, sponsored by Senator Ibrahim Dankwambo of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Gombe North, passed second reading during Wednesday’s plenary. 					<description><![CDATA[<p>The Senate Committee on Public Accounts has given the Bank of Agriculture (BOA), Nigerian Security Printing and Minting Company (NSPMC), and Rural Electrification Agency (REA) one week to appear before the committee and address outstanding audit queries.
